Optimización y formateo de código JSON para desarrolladores
Formateo de CódigoDesarrollo Web
Formateo de Código, Desarrollo Web

Optimización y formateo de código JSON para desarrolladores

Publicado el 15 de marzo de 2025

Optimización y formateo de código JSON para desarrolladores

El formateo adecuado del código JSON es esencial para el desarrollo web moderno. En este artículo, exploramos cómo nuestro Formateador de JSON puede ayudarte a mejorar la legibilidad de tu código, detectar errores de sintaxis y optimizar la estructura de tus datos.

¿Por qué es importante formatear JSON?

El JSON (JavaScript Object Notation) se ha convertido en el estándar de facto para el intercambio de datos en aplicaciones web. Un JSON bien formateado ofrece múltiples ventajas:

    1. Legibilidad mejorada: Facilita la comprensión de estructuras de datos complejas
    2. Detección de errores: Permite identificar rápidamente problemas de sintaxis
    3. Mantenimiento simplificado: Hace que el código sea más fácil de mantener y actualizar
    4. Colaboración eficiente: Mejora la comunicación entre equipos de desarrollo

Técnicas avanzadas para trabajar con JSON

Manejo de estructuras anidadas complejas

Aprenderás técnicas para trabajar con JSON anidados complejos, como:

json

{

"usuario": {

"perfil": {

"nombre": "Juan",

"preferencias": {

"tema": "oscuro",

"notificaciones": true

}

},

"historial": [

{ "accion": "login", "fecha": "2025-03-10" },

{ "accion": "cambio_perfil", "fecha": "2025-03-12" }

]

}

}

Validación de estructura con esquemas

Explicamos cómo validar la estructura de tus JSON según esquemas predefinidos utilizando herramientas como JSON Schema:

  1. Definir un esquema que describa la estructura esperada
  2. Validar documentos JSON contra ese esquema
  3. Generar documentación automática a partir del esquema

Conversión entre formatos de datos

Nuestro formateador también te permite convertir entre diferentes formatos de datos:

| Formato | Ventajas | Casos de uso |

|---------|----------|--------------|

| JSON | Ligero, fácil de leer | APIs, configuraciones |

| XML | Estructurado, metadatos | Documentos, SOAP |

| YAML | Legibilidad humana | Configuraciones, CI/CD |

| CSV | Tabular, compatible con Excel | Datos tabulares, reportes |

Depuración y mantenimiento de aplicaciones

También explicamos cómo el formateo adecuado puede facilitar la depuración y el mantenimiento de aplicaciones que consumen APIs. Aprenderás a:

    1. Identificar problemas en respuestas de API
    2. Comparar cambios entre diferentes versiones de datos
    3. Optimizar el tamaño de payloads JSON
    4. Implementar estrategias de caché para datos JSON

Con ejemplos prácticos y casos de uso reales, este artículo te mostrará cómo aprovechar al máximo nuestra herramienta de formateo JSON para mejorar tu flujo de trabajo de desarrollo.

Herramienta relacionada

Prueba nuestra herramienta relacionada con este artículo:

Ir a la herramienta

¿Quieres contribuir?

Si tienes ideas para mejorar nuestro blog o quieres colaborar con un artículo, visita nuestro repositorio en GitHub o contáctanos directamente.